متن کاملSPSB1 may have MET its match during breast cancer recurrence.
SUMMARY Disease recurrence is the most common cause of death for patients with breast cancer, yet little is known about the molecular mechanisms underlying this process. Using inducible transgenic mouse model systems, Feng and colleagues identified SPSB1 as a determinant of breast cancer recurrence by virtue of its ability to protect tumor cells from apoptosis through c-MET activation.

متن کاملTargeting MET in Lung Cancer: Will Expectations Finally Be MET?
The hepatocyte growth factor receptor (MET) is a potential therapeutic target in a number of cancers, including NSCLC. In NSCLC, MET pathway activation is thought to occur through a diverse set of mechanisms that influence properties affecting cancer cell survival, growth, and invasiveness.
